The Development Bank of Southern Africa (“DBSA”) is a development finance institution wholly owned by the South African Government. Its purpose is to accelerate sustainable socio-economic development to improve the quality of life of the people in South Africa, SADC and Rest of Africa by providing financial and non-financial investments in the social and economic infrastructure sectors. The DBSA support South Africa’s regional integration agenda through providing development finance for infrastructure projects in four priority sectors; energy (including renewable energy and energy efficiency), transportation (road, rail and ports), bulk water and ICT, across Africa.
